Output e200c86556f1514bd175ec33369f078c1d4b9f4a45e3a2037e4987fec6ed4f03:5

value
83640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bded6c77cd637979c12b9cdda97424d7f683b3 OP_EQUAL
address
3CWsBZycHDZmuFQ5yi6faQo6BTXhqjLcYD
transaction
e200c86556f1514bd175ec33369f078c1d4b9f4a45e3a2037e4987fec6ed4f03
spent
true